The United States Men's National Team (USMNT) continued its strong start in the 2026 World Cup with a 2-0 victory over Australia at Lumen Field on June 19. Folarin Balogun's efforts, including an assist on an own goal, highlighted the team’s effective pressing strategy. Despite missing key player Christian Pulisic, the US team maintained a high energy level and successfully forced mistakes from their opponents. The win places the USMNT in a favorable position before their final group stage match, where a draw could secure them top spot.
